First off, I started thinking about how to make this trip happen. I knew there were a few options: by plane, by train, or by bus. I decided to look into each one.
I checked the flight prices first. I went to some popular travel websites and searched for flights between Milano and Paris. The prices were kind of all over the place. Some airlines had really cheap deals, but the flight times were super early in the morning or late at night. And then there were the more expensive ones with better schedules. I compared a bunch of them, but in the end, I wasn’t too keen on flying because of the airport security hassle and the limited luggage allowance.
Next, I turned to the train. I visited the train company’s website and looked at the schedules and fares. The high – speed trains seemed really convenient. They had a lot of departures throughout the day, and the journey time was reasonable. The tickets were a bit pricey, but I thought it would be worth it for the comfort and the views along the way.
